a. The area of a sheet of paper is 100 square inches. Write an equation that gives the area, \( A \), of the sheet of paper, in square inches, after being folded in half \( n \) times

When you fold a sheet of paper in half, its area is halved with each fold. Therefore, after \( n \) folds, the area can be expressed with the equation \( A = \frac{100}{2^n} \). This means that after every fold, the area will decrease exponentially based on the number of times you've folded it.
